The first step to learning any language is to master its pronunciation. Chinese pronunciation can be tricky for native English speakers, but it is not impossible. The key is to practice regularly and to listen to native speakers as much as possible.
Here are some tips for pronouncing Chinese:
* Start by learning the four Mandarin tones. The tone of your voice can change the meaning of a word, so it is important to get this right.
* Pay attention to the pinyin, which is the romanization of Chinese characters. This can help you to learn the pronunciation of new words.
* Listen to native speakers as much as possible. This will help you to get used to the natural rhythm and flow of the language.Grammar
Chinese grammar is relatively simple compared to other languages. However, there are a few key differences that you need to be aware of.
Here are some of the most important grammar rules in Chinese:
* Subject-verb-object word order.
* No articles (a, an, the).
* No verb tenses.
* Use of measure words.Vocabulary
The best way to build your Chinese vocabulary is to immerse yourself in the language. This means listening to Chinese music, watching Chinese films and television, and reading Chinese newspapers and books.
You can also use a Chinese dictionary or app to learn new words. However, it is important to remember that context is key. Try to learn new words in the context of a sentence or conversation.Resources
